The 97% acceptance rate at university defines its selectivity in admissions. With academic success as the core, University holds a graduation rate of 41%. University allows applicants to self-report SAT/ACT scores, with official scores required upon admissions as per Required A good score in the Ielts, Toefl is essential for securing a seat here.

It considers 430-540 as the required SAT Math score for admission. The SAT Evidence-Based Reading and Writing score of accepted students is 440-540. The typical ACT Composite score of admitted students is 17-22. All admitted students possess an ACT English score of 15-21. The ACT Math score among admitted students is 16-21.
The in-state tuition fees at this university is $9, 840. The Students residing outside the state have to pay $17, 030 as a tuition fee at this university. Students at this university need to pay $10, 200 for room and board. This university charges $4, 300 for room and Other Expenses. The grand total of education-related costs, including every expense, is $24, 340.

The college's commitment to quality education is evident in its student-faculty ratio of 14.0. Maintaining a gender balance, the institution records a male-female ratio of 0.7, ensuring a fair learning environment.
